Job Description
SUMMARY
Monitor, report, and correct process discrepancies, as well as working with the operations team to implement and maintain best practices with respect to quality and consumer satisfaction, while assisting with production. M-F 7:30am-4:00pm. The is an onsite position.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Maintain Quality standards. Identify and implement corrective actions and training when necessary. Monitor and maintain process and reporting guidelines to meet Nintendo’s and/or United Radio’s operating standards. Ensure corrective actions are taken to minimize the incidence of technical or process failure in the Nintendo Department. Audit the operators and facilities to ensure compliance with Nintendo of America’s operation standards. Working within a production role as needed and assisting with production flow.
QUALIFICATIONS
High school diploma or general education degree (GED). Ability to read and comprehend simple instructions, short correspondence, and memos. Ability to effectively present information in one-on-one and small group situations to co-workers. Must possess interpersonal skills, and organizational skills. Must be detail-oriented.
